The mechanical properties of concrete mixed with quarry dust as a fine aggregate were investigated in this paper. This research showed that natural river sand was substituted with quarry dust in a range of 0-100%. The compressive and tensile strength of the concrete increased when river sand was replaced with quarry dust.

Results showed that replacing 50% of fine aggregate with quarry dust gave a concrete with a maximum compressive strength of 25.10 N/mm2 on the 28th day of curing, when compared with all other replacement levels, including the control. Also, there was a significant decrease in workability as the percentage of quarry dust increased.

Conventional concrete of grade M40 was considered for comparison. 100% replacement of fine aggregate in which 75% quarry dust and 25% granite fines combination achieved 40MPa strength at 28day age. Hence the study concludes over extraction of natural sand from river beds can be reduced by replacing it with quarry dust and granite fines with ...

been conducted on the use of Quarry dust as partial replacement for fine aggregate; according to Celik and Mirra (1996) the compressive and flexural strength of concrete increased with addition of Quarry dust up to 10% replacement level, the impact resistance of the concrete also improved with 5% of the dust content.
